MARTIN v. HAMLIN

No. 73799.

25 S.W.3d 718 (2000)

Terry Donald MARTIN, Relator, v. Jim HAMLIN, District Clerk of Dallas County, Respondent.

Court of Criminal Appeals of Texas.

May 10, 2000.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Terry Donald Martin, pro se.

Bill Hill, Dist. Atty., Dallas, Matthew Paul, State's Atty., Austin, for the State.


OPINION

The opinion was delivered PER CURIAM.

This is a motion for leave to file an original application for writ of mandamus. Relator filed an Article 11.07, V.A.C.C.P., application for writ of habeas corpus in the 203 rd Judicial District Court of Dallas County on December 23, 1997.
